Auf Wiedersehen Pet Season 2 Episode 13
Watch Auf Wiedersehen Pet Season 2 Episode 13 full online free without downloading, english subs, hd quality
Watch Auf Wiedersehen Pet Season 2 Episode 13 full online free without downloading, english subs, hd quality